Job Description

We are seeking a Construction Project Manager that will be responsible for estimating and providing project management of multiple and concurrent projects in the Federal/Public business sector. The Project Manager will ensure their assigned projects are successful for all involved parties and are profitable for Company Group. They will ensure their assigned projects are managed in a method that maximizes safety, quality, and customer service.

Construction Project Manager

Location(s): Charlotte, NC

Salary Range: 90K – 130K

Permanent Position, Full Benefits: Yes

Relocation Assistance Available - Yes

Responsibilities:

  • Assisting in the preparation of bids by working with senior project manager regarding constructability issues.
  • Prepare quantity take-offs for proposals.
  • Solicit material and subcontractor pricing for resources required for project bids.
  • Work with Senior Project Manager, Field Operations, and the Equipment Department to arrange and manage company resources on all projects.
  • Represent company in a professional manner to public/clients at pre-bid meetings and project meetings.
  • When needed, work at project sites to direct/assist Superintendents/Foremen.
  • Travel to Company Group offices as needed.
  • Maintain a positive attitude and good working relationships with customers, employees, and the public.
  • Prepare estimates.

Requirements and Qualifications

  • 5+ years of industry heavy civil/site work construction project management experience; (Roadway, DOT, Highway, Concrete Structures, Excavation, Utilities, Asphalt Paving, Concrete, Design & Build Projects).
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Construction Management or Civil Engineering or equivalent field experience in Civil Construction.
  • Must be a self-starter with collaborative, entrepreneurial spirit, and willingness to think outside the box.
  • Develop and maintain positive relationships with internal and external customers.
  • Train, educate and assist field representatives on the construction sites.
  • Must be able to work flexible hours, including evenings and weekends as required.
  • Must have, or the ability and background to attain, a TWIC (Transportation Worker Identification Credential) card issued by the TSA.
  • Work approximately 50 – 55 hours a week.
